Performance
The Google Pixel 7a’s Tensor G2 (5nm) chipset, with its Cortex-X1 prime core clocked at 2.85 GHz, offers a substantial performance advantage over the Redmi Note 14 4G’s MediaTek Helio G99 Ultra (6nm). The Tensor G2’s architecture, including the Cortex-A78 performance cores, provides faster processing speeds for demanding tasks like video editing and gaming. While the Helio G99 Ultra is a capable chip for everyday use, the Tensor G2’s 5nm fabrication process also contributes to better thermal efficiency, potentially reducing throttling during sustained workloads. The Pixel 7a’s performance is geared towards a smoother, more responsive user experience.

Buying Guide
Buy the Xiaomi Redmi Note 14 4G if you need exceptional battery life, prioritize value for money, and primarily use your phone for everyday tasks like calling, texting, and social media. Buy the Google Pixel 7a if you prefer a superior camera experience, a cleaner software interface with guaranteed updates, and benefit from Google’s AI-powered features, even if it means sacrificing some battery life.
